hormonal acne is unfortunately caused from the inside out, so i would recommend finding out how/why it's being caused because skincare cannot and wouldn't do much in fixing the cause, but only treating the symptoms. propolis as an ingredient calmed my hormonal cysts and i've realised that for my skin, heats makes it worse/feel more uncomfortable. propolis does this, but i would probably say the i'm from mugwort mask is my HG product because it cools is down so quickly. the toner didn't do much. my hormonal acne almost completely stopped when i stopped taking any vit D supplements, so now it's more about trying to reduce the PIH that those breakouts have left me with. my routine then and now hasn't changed much! i focused on hydrating and soothing products, so naturie toner, hada labo premium whitening lotion, pyungkang yul essence toner, propolis serum/essence.

vit D is less a vitamin and more of a hormone! i knew this fact before, but i didn't know it could actually cause such bad cystic acne till it happened to me. i'm deficient as well, but i will talk to my doctor soon about what to do instead of supplementing because the pain and effects on my self-esteem (mental health) were bad and not something i'm ok with!
